Notes
English: The original canvas is oval and has been made up to a rectangle. Archibald Hope (1664-1743), of the Hopes of Hopetoun, was a Scottish merchant who was born and lived in Rotterdam. His sons set up the Hope Bank in Amsterdam. The art collector and theorist Thomas Hope of Deepdene was his grandson. Copy in Rotterdam Archives.
